博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Centos学习路线图
阅读量:6257 次
发布时间:2019-06-22

本文共 876 字,大约阅读时间需要 2 分钟。

Linux系统的重要性就不要解释了,也造就了现在越来越多的IT从业人员和大学生们转战Linux。但对Linux新人来说,Linux到底学了什么知识,到达了何种程度,一直是个困惑。今天就整理下Linux不同阶段对应的知识体系,即Linux的学习路线图。

Linux初级工程师

对于新手来说,选择一个适合的发行版和一本好的教材,就开始正式踏入Linux的大门了。在此阶段,需要掌握的知识如下:

lLinux图形界面的使用

lLinux简单目录结构

lLinux常用命令

lLinux系统安装

掌握了以上知识,可以说已经是一个Linux的初级工程师了,对于Linux操作系统的使及简单维护,是完全可以胜任的。

Linux中级工程师

经过了初级阶段,接下来需要学习掌握以下知识:

lLinux用户/文件系统管理

lLinux网络管理

lLinux磁盘管理

lLinux系统和日志维护管理

lLinux安全优化

lLinux系统备份与恢复

lShell初步编程

掌握了以上知识,就完全可以胜任一般中小企业的Linux服务器的管理了。

Linux高级工程师

如果想在Linux界有所成就,就需要学习更高级的知识:

l服务器管理方面

nLinux DNS服务器

nLinux NIS服务器

nLinux Mail服务器

nLinux Web服务器

nLinux FTP服务器

nLinux文件服务器-Samba、NFS

nLAMP服务器管理

nLinux群集

l开发方面:

nShell高级编程

nC语言开发

n内核基础

n嵌入式开发

nLinux驱动开发

根据自己兴趣,可以选择不同的方向。

当然,随着技术的发展,还需要有紧跟时代的新技术的学习,如Linux下的虚拟化与云计算,Linux群集高级应用等。

如果在学习知识的同时,把相应等级的Linux证书也考下来,那么,成为Linux界的技术大牛也就指日可待了。

本文出自 “跟我学Linux” 博客,请务必保留此出处http://zhangqingli.blog.51cto.com/796670/1316089

转载地址:http://dyxsa.baihongyu.com/

你可能感兴趣的文章
oracle 按照中文排序
查看>>
免费实用的看图工具 Xee
查看>>
我的友情链接
查看>>
Linux 下sendmail 的加密与认证
查看>>
自我成长及沟通技巧
查看>>
【Practical API Design学习笔记】谨慎使用第三方API
查看>>
体验 Scala 2.12 支持的 Java 8 风格(SAM) Lambda
查看>>
Nicholas C. Zakas:我得到的最佳职业生涯建议
查看>>
openfire学习总结之插件
查看>>
UDT协议实现分析——UDT数据收发的可靠性保障
查看>>
谷歌将降低侵权网站的排名
查看>>
知识图谱的应用
查看>>
springboot 系列教程一:基础项目搭建
查看>>
Rxjava2 源码解析 (三)
查看>>
ios cocoapods 0.32.1 升级提示不行 要安装cocoapods-core
查看>>
匿名函数和闭包
查看>>
Overfitting
查看>>
Open vSwitch 简介
查看>>
Composer
查看>>
Go Little Book - 关于本书
查看>>